I’ve been working with an outstanding group of librarians this Spring on developing the required policies and forms required under the Freedom to Read Act, and thought a review and update of the work might be helpful. 

Under the law, the State Librarian is required to work with the New Jersey Library Association to develop model curation (collection development) and request for reconsideration policies and a model request for reconsideration form by December 4, 2025. Our working group is just now completing a version of each for final review and acceptance.
